Determination of bonding strength in heat treated some wood materials

Abstract

This study was carried out to determine the bonding strength of PVAc-D4 adhesive in the heat treated for some wood materials. For this purpose, bonding strentgh of the Oriental beech (Fagus orientalis L.), oak (Quercus petraea L.), scots pine (Pinus sylvestris L.) and poplar (Populus nigra L.) woods was determined according to BS EN 205 after the samples were subjected to heat treatment of 150, 175 and 200 ºC for 2 hours, for total 38 hours and prepared with PVAc-D4 glue according to BS EN 204. As a result, bonding strength of parallel to grain of the control samples subjected to heat treatment generally decreased. The highest bonding strength of parallel to grain was obtained for oak samples subjected to heat treatment at 150 ºC (15,97 N/mm2), the lowest bonding strength of parallel to grain was obtained for poplar samples subjected to heat treatment at 200 ºC (4,10 N/mm2). Accordingly, oak may give better results for bounding with PVAc- D4 glue of wood materials subjected heat treatment. In addition, losses of bounding strength may be minimized with investigating different methods and heat treatment conditions. Keywords: Heat treatment, Bonding strength, Wood material, PVAc-D4
